WARNING!!
NEVER APPLY POWER TO THIS AMPLIFIER WITH THE COVER REMOVED!
CONTACT WITH THE VOLTAGES INSIDE THIS AMPLIFIER CAN BE FATAL!
PLEASE READ THIS MANUAL BEFORE ATTEMPING TO OPERATE
EQUIPMENT! Improper or abusive operation of this amplifier can damage the tubes
or other components in this amplifier. Damage caused by improper or abusive
operation is not covered under the warranty policy.
